Izmir saat kulesi

view map

Built in 1901 this Saat Kulesi or clock tower has become the landmark of Izmir. The city might have had others, but in 1922 a fire destroyed, during the Greek-Turkish war, most of the old city. A terrible loss. The clock tower is at Konak, which can be considered the heart of the city. The sea is at two hundred meters, but as you can read in a comment below, it used to be at the seaside in the twenties. The shopping area of the bazar a similar distance to the other side.
